The ADHD Testing Process
The testing procedure for ADHD generally includes numerous phases, combining numerous assessment tools and interviews. Below is a detailed guide:
Step 1: Initial Consultation
Throughout the very first visit, the clinician collects a comprehensive history of symptoms, medical concerns, and any family history of ADHD or associated conditions. They might utilize screening questionnaires to assess symptoms.
Action 2: Clinical Interviews
The clinician typically carries out interviews not just with the specific but often with relative or buddies to get different viewpoints on behavioral patterns.
Action 3: Standardized Tests and Questionnaires
Various standardized tools and assessments can assist prove the medical diagnosis. Below is a list of frequently used tools:
Assessment ToolDescriptionAdult ADHD Self-Report Scale (ASRS)A survey that helps determine symptoms constant with ADHD.Wender Utah Rating ScaleExamines symptoms during youth and adolescence.Barkley Adult ADHD Rating ScaleProduces a profile of symptom severity through self-reporting.Conners Adult ADHD Rating ScaleA comprehensive survey that captures habits and history.Step 4: Rule Out Other Conditions
ADHD can exist together with other disorders (e.g., stress and anxiety, learning impairments, mood disorders). An extensive evaluation assists distinguish ADHD symptoms from those of other mental health challenges.
Step 5: Diagnosis
Based on the gathered info, the clinician will make a medical diagnosis according to the Diagnostic and Statistical Manual of Mental Disorders (DSM-5) criteria. This includes evidence demonstrating that the symptoms considerably hindered the person's operating in a minimum of 2 settings (e.g., work and home).
Step 6: Treatment Planning
Once a medical diagnosis is validated, the clinician collaborates with the private to establish a tailored treatment plan, which may include medication, treatment (such as cognitive-behavioral treatment), and way of life adjustments.

A qualified healthcare specialist can carry out the evaluation. This consists of psychologists, psychiatrists, or other qualified mental health professionals experienced in detecting and dealing with ADHD.
Can ADHD be identified in the adult years if I didn't have it detected as a kid?
Yes, it is possible for ADHD to go undiagnosed in youth however still present in adulthood. Many adults acknowledge symptoms that were never officially detected in their youth, causing their current assessment.
